Understanding the Basics: What Are Discord and Patreon?

Before diving into the creation process, it’s important to understand the platforms themselves. Discord is a communication platform initially designed for gamers, but it has evolved into a versatile tool for communities of all types. With features like text channels, voice chats, and integration capabilities, Discord provides a dynamic environment for interaction and engagement.

On the other hand, Patreon is a membership platform that allows creators to offer exclusive content and experiences to their subscribers, known as patrons. Patrons subscribe to a creator’s page, often paying a recurring fee, in exchange for perks like early access to content, behind-the-scenes insights, or personalized interactions.

Both platforms serve as powerful tools for building communities, but they target different aspects of interaction. While Discord focuses on real-time communication and engagement, Patreon emphasizes content monetization and exclusive access. Together, they can create a robust ecosystem for a paid community.

Step-by-Step Guide: How to Create a Paid Community on Discord or Patreon

Creating a paid community involves strategic planning and execution. Below is a step-by-step guide to help you navigate the process.

  1. Define Your Value Proposition:

    Before launching your community, determine what unique value you offer. What makes your content or interaction worth paying for? This could be exclusive content, personalized mentorship, access to expert knowledge, or a vibrant community experience. Having a clear value proposition will help you attract the right audience.

  2. Choose the Right Platform:

    Decide whether Discord or Patreon (or a combination of both) suits your needs. If your focus is on real-time interaction and community engagement, Discord is ideal. If monetization and providing exclusive content are your priorities, Patreon might be the better choice. Evaluate the features and pricing models of each platform before making a decision.

  3. Set Up Your Platform:

    Once you’ve chosen your platform, set up your community space. For Discord, this involves creating channels, setting roles and permissions, and integrating bots for automation. For Patreon, you’ll need to create tiers, define rewards, and prepare your page layout. Be sure to personalize your space to reflect your brand’s identity.

  4. Develop a Content Plan:

    Content is the backbone of your community. Plan out the types of content you’ll offer and how often you’ll update it. This could include tutorials, live Q&A sessions, exclusive articles, or community challenges. Consistency is key to keeping your members engaged and satisfied.

  5. Launch and Promote Your Community:

    With everything in place, it’s time to launch your community. Announce it on your existing platforms, such as social media, newsletters, or your website. Use compelling storytelling to highlight the benefits of joining your community. Encourage your existing audience to spread the word and offer incentives for early sign-ups.

By following these steps, you’ll be well on your way to establishing a thriving paid community on Discord or Patreon.

Challenges and Misconceptions in Building a Paid Community

Challenges and Misconceptions in Building a Paid Community

Building a paid community is not without its challenges. One common misconception is that simply setting up a community will automatically lead to a steady stream of income. In reality, it requires ongoing effort to maintain and grow your community.

A challenge many creators face is pricing their community offerings. Setting the right price can be tricky, as you need to balance affordability with the value you provide. Consider offering multiple tiers to cater to different audience segments and testing different pricing models to find what works best.

Another challenge is maintaining engagement. Without regular interaction and fresh content, members may lose interest. To combat this, create a content calendar and schedule regular events or updates. Additionally, be responsive to member feedback and adapt your offerings accordingly.

Lastly, some creators struggle with feeling overwhelmed by managing a community. It’s important to set boundaries and delegate tasks if needed. Use tools like bots to automate routine tasks on Discord, and consider hiring moderators to assist with community management.

By addressing these challenges head-on, you can create a sustainable and rewarding paid community experience.

Bonus Tips for Success and Advanced Insights

To truly excel in building a paid community on Discord or Patreon, consider implementing these advanced strategies:

  • Leverage Analytics: Use analytics tools to track member engagement, content performance, and revenue. This data-driven approach allows you to make informed decisions and refine your strategies over time.
  • Collaborate with Influencers: Partnering with influencers or other creators in your niche can expand your reach and attract new members. Cross-promotion can be beneficial for both parties involved.
  • Offer Limited-Time Promotions: Create urgency by offering limited-time discounts or exclusive content for new members. This can drive sign-ups and create buzz around your community launch.
  • Explore Future Trends: Stay updated with trends in community management and platform features. For instance, Discord’s integration with NFTs or Patreon’s expansion into new content types could present new opportunities for your community.

These strategies can help you not only establish but also grow and sustain a successful paid community.
